Q What qualifications are needed for a Cybersecurity Analyst job in North Carolina?
A Qualifications commonly required for a Cybersecurity Analyst job in North Carolina include a Bachelor's degree in Information Technology, Cybersecurity, or a related field, relevant work experience, industry certifications such as CISSP, CISM or CompTIA Security+, and strong knowledge of security protocols, IT systems, and networking concepts.
Q What duties does a Cybersecurity Analyst perform in North Carolina?
A A Cybersecurity Analyst in North Carolina is responsible for monitoring an organization's networks for security breaches, investigating violations when they occur, installing and using software to protect sensitive information, preparing reports on the findings, and collaborating with network staff to fix security issues.
Q What is the demand for Cybersecurity Analysts in North Carolina?
A The demand for Cybersecurity Analysts in North Carolina is generally high, as organizations increasingly prioritize cybersecurity to protect their data and systems against cyber threats. The presence of the Research Triangle Park and numerous tech companies contributes to a steady demand in the cybersecurity job market.
